Getting There
-
Car
If you are traveling by car, from the center of Alexandria Bay, head south on James Street. Continue straight as it becomes Fuller Street. Scenic View Park will be on your right at 8 Fuller St, Alexandria Bay, NY 13607. There is free parking available near the park entrance.
